A resident or nonresident may use a rubber powered gun, spring gun, or compressed air gun to take native rough fish and common carp by harpooning. The harpoon must be fastened to a line not more than 20 feet long. The commissioner may prescribe the times, the waters, and the manner for harpooning native rough fish and common carp.
Minn. Stat. § 97C.381
HARPOONING NATIVE ROUGH FISH.
